Moisture Mapping A Guide to Detection Methods

Moisture Mapping

Moisture mapping is the process of identifying areas of moisture in a building or structure. It involves using specialized equipment to detect and measure moisture levels in various materials, such as walls, floors, and ceilings. Moisture mapping can be performed for a variety of reasons, including:

  • Identifying the source of moisture problems
  • Assessing the extent of water damage
  • Monitoring moisture levels over time
  • Preventing future moisture problems

Detection Methods

There are a number of different moisture detection methods that can be used, depending on the specific needs of the situation. Some of the most common methods include:

  • Infrared thermography: This method uses an infrared camera to detect differences in temperature, which can indicate areas of moisture.
  • Moisture meters: These devices measure the electrical resistance of materials to estimate moisture content.
  • Hygrometers: These devices measure the relative humidity of the air, which can be an indication of moisture problems.
  • Visual inspection: This method involves looking for signs of moisture damage, such as stains, discoloration, and mold growth.
